Income Tax Deadline
The income tax deadline for your federal tax return is approaching. Your 2009 tax return and any outstanding tax is due April 15, 2010.
To be considered filed on time, your tax return must be postmarked by the tax deadline.
If you don’t get your taxes filed by the income tax deadline, you can file an extension, which will automatically give you an extra six months to file.
You will not, however, get an extension to pay your taxes. To avoid any penalties, you’ll still need to pay your taxes due by April 15.
The income tax deadline for tax returns with an extension is October 15, 2010.
